読者です 読者をやめる 読者になる 読者になる

pingに日付を表示したい

コマンドで一発 ping localhost | while read pong; do echo "$(date): $pong"; done

windows10 キーボードレイアウトを日本語に変更

[スタート] を右クリックし、コンテキストメニューから [ファイル名を指定して実行(R)] を選択 regeditと入力し、「OK」ボタンを押す 下記のレジストリキーを開く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\i8042prt\Parameters レジ…

ubuntu14.04 キーボードレイアウトを日本語版へ変更

Ubuntu Serverをインストールした後、デスクトップをapt-getでインストールすると、キーボードレイアウトが英語版になってしまう。 以下の設定で日本語キーボードに変更できる $ sudo vi /etc/default/keyboard - XKBLAYOUT=”jp” + XKBLAYOUT=”jp,jp” $ sudo…

Gitlabをサブディレクトリ運用

# vi /var/opt/gitlab/gitlab-shell/config.yml - #gitlab_url: "http://127.0.0.1:8080" + gitlab_url: "http://127.0.0.1:8080/gitlab" # vi /opt/gitlab/embedded/service/gitlab-rails/config/gitlab.yml - # relative_url_root: /gitlab + relative_url…

CentOS7でDockerを使う

環境 CentOS7 最小構成インストール HDD 300GB Mem 2GB NIC 1 インストール手順 パッケージをアップデートしておく # yum update SELinuxを無効化 # vi /etc/selinux/config - SELINUX=enforcing + SELINUX=disabled 起動時のコンソールログを表示させる設定…

Ubuntu14.10のRemminaでWindows10にRDPアクセスができない

Windows8.1 proからwindows 10 proへアップグレードした後、UbuntuのRemminaでリモートデスクトップアクセスができなくなってしまいました。 以下のようなエラーメッセージが出力されます。 「RDPサーバーxxxxに接続できません」 クライアントのLinuxマシン…

Linux(Ubuntu)とWindowsで特定のユーザー権限でフォルダ共有

Sambaサーバー側での作業 パッケージインストール $ sudo apt-get install samba sambaの設定ファイルを編集。以下を追加 $ vi /etc/samba/smb.conf [global] #map to guest = bad user #Linux に存在しないユーザーでのアクセスはゲストとして扱う hosts al…

railsでサイトマップを作成する

準備 Gemfileに以下を追加 gem 'sitemap_generator' 追加したらbundle install。 インストールできたら以下のコマンドを実行 $ rake sitemap:install 実行するとconfig/sitemap.rbが作成されるので これに、作成したいサイトマップの設定を書いていきます。 …

ubuntu14.04(Linux全般)同士でノンパスワードでSSHできるようにする

サーバー側の操作 秘密鍵と公開鍵を作成する $ ssh-keygen -t rsa Generating public/private rsa key pair. Enter file in which to save the key (/home/hoge/.ssh/id_rsa): Enter passphrase (empty for no passphrase): #クライアント側操作で必要に>な…

KVMでクローニング

仮想マシン一覧から、クローニング元にする仮想マシンを確認 # virsh list --all Id 名前 状態 ---------------------------------- 2 vm32-2 実行中 3 vm32-3 実行中 4 vm32-1 実行中 今回は4の vm32-1をクローニング対象とする。 クローニング対象のVMを停…

DD-WRTでsamba公開したディレクトリのマウント

ユーザー名: hoge パスワード: hogehoge uid: fuga gid: fugafuga ルーターのIP: 192.168.1.1 公開フォルダ: /share マウント先: /mnt/ddwrt cifs-utilsがインストールされていること。されてない場合は以下 $ sudo apt-get install -y cifs-utils 以下のコ…

RHEL6.0でKVM環境を構築する

環境 rehel 6.0 KVM環境構築の流れ KVMの導入 ネットワークの構成 ストレージの接続設定 仮想マシンの構成 1. KVMの導入 RHELのインストールの項目と指定するパラーメーターを以下の表に記述する 項目 指定するパラメーター インストーラーの言語 Japanese(…

ruby on railsでbootstrap calendarを導入

最初に完成したデモ DEMO http://workshops.ddns.net/event_calendar/show 必要なものをダウンロード $ git clone https://github.com/Serhioromano/bootstrap-calendar.git jQuery, underscore.js, bootstrap コントローラーの生成 $ rails g controller ev…

Ubuntu14.04 Serverインストール後の日本語設定

日本語でインストールしても、文字化けするので以下のように設定する $ vi ~/.bashrc case $TERM in linux)LANG=C ;; *)LANG=ja_JP.UTF-8 ;; esac $ source ~/.bashrc これでOK 参考 http://www.alb.jp/%E3%82%B3%E3%83%B3%E3%83%94%E3%83%A5%E3%83%BC%E3%82…

ruby on rails でAjaxを使いcontrollerのメソッドを動かす

views/albums/_form.html.erb <%= button_tag type: 'button', :id => 'get-near-albums' do %> <%= 'Start Ajax' %> <% end %> javascript $("#get-near-albums").click(function(){ $.ajax({ url: "get_near_albums", type: "GET", }).done(function(data)…

ubuntu14.04にgemでrmagickをインストール

まず、gem install してみる $ gem install rmagick -v '2.14.0' Building native extensions. This could take a while... ERROR: Error installing rmagick: ERROR: Failed to build gem native extension. /home/hoge/.rbenv/versions/2.1.5/bin/ruby ext…

ruby on railsで任意のJavascript CSSを読み込む(production環境)

目的 ページごとに読み込むJavascript, CSSを指定する。 今回の構成 top#indexで以下のファイルを読み込む app/assets/javascripts/hoge/hogehoge.js app/assets/stylesheets/hoge/hogehoge.css アプリケーション全体でbootstrap.jsを読み込む 環境 Rails 4.…

ruby on rails 4でbootstrap3を適用

Gemfileに以下を追加 $ vi Gemfile gem 'twitter-bootstrap3-rails' $ bundle install CSSとJSを追加する $ rails generate bootstrap:install static "Could not find a JavaScript runtime"のようなエラーが出る場合は以下のコマンドを実行 $ sudo apt-get…

Windows7からUbuntu 14.04にリモートデスクトップ接続

接続される側(Ubuntu14.04)の設定 インストール $ sudo apt-get install xrdp lxde 設定 $ echo lxsession -s LXDE -e LXDE > ~/.xsession $ sudo vi /etc/xrdp/xrdp.ini crypt_levelをlowからhighにする xrdp1セクションのport=-1をask=-1にする 端末を起動…

Ubuntu14.04にrbenvを用いてrubyをインストール

Ubuntu 14.04にrbenvを使ってRuby On Railsを導入 rbenvによるバージョン管理を意識した導入を目的としています 環境 OS: ubuntu 14.04 64bit $ cat /etc/lsb-release DISTRIB_ID=Ubuntu DISTRIB_RELEASE=14.04 DISTRIB_CODENAME=trusty DISTRIB_DESCRIPTION…

Ubuntu14.04にSublime Text3をインストール

ubuntu14.04にSublime text 3のインストール (2014年12/15) 下記URLからSublime Text 3をダウンロード http://www.sublimetext.com/3 Ubuntu 64 bit - also available as a tarball for other Linux distributions. を選択 $ sudo dpkg -i sublime-text_buil…

SoftLayerについて備忘録

SoftLayerについて 他のクラウドベンダーとの違い サーバ+ストレージ+ネットワークの基盤を提供:IaaS 仮想サーバ、物理サーバを提供できる。 パフォーマンスとセキュリティを重視 世界中のデータセンターを高速ネットワークで接続 通常日本からアマゾンを…

ubuntu12.04にSublime text 3をインストール

ubuntu12.04にSublime text 3のインストール (2014年7/27) 下記URLからSublime Text 3をダウンロード http://www.sublimetext.com/3 Ubuntu 32 bit - also available as a tarball for other Linux distributions. を選択 $ sudo dpkg -i sublime-text_build…

Ubuntu14.04インストール後に行う設定

14.04インストール後の設定 まずはアップデート $ sudo apt-get update; sudo apt-get -y upgrade; sudo apt-get dist-upgrade -y Dashのオンライン検索を無効にする システム設定ー>プライバシーー>アクティビティの記録ー>オフ もし有効にすることがな…

VgrantでインストールしたUbuntu ServerにRuby On Railsをインストール

Vagrantで導入した仮想マシン(ubuntu12.04 minimal server)にRuby On Railsをインストールする 環境 ホストOS $ cat /etc/lsb-release DISTRIB_ID=Ubuntu DISTRIB_RELEASE=12.04 DISTRIB_CODENAME=precise DISTRIB_DESCRIPTION="Ubuntu 12.04.4 LTS" vagra…

Ubuntu 12.04にrbenvを使ってRuby On Railsを導入

Ubuntu 12.04にrbenvを使ってRuby On Railsを導入 rbenvによるバージョン管理を意識した導入を目的としています 環境 OS: ubuntu 12.04 $ cat /etc/lsb-release DISTRIB_ID=Ubuntu DISTRIB_RELEASE=12.04 DISTRIB_CODENAME=precise DISTRIB_DESCRIPTION="Ubu…

ubuntu12.04にVagrantのインストールからポートフォワード設定して外部からsshするまで

ubuntu12.04にvgrantをインストール 環境 ホストOS : ubuntu 12.04(32bit) VirtualBox : VirtualBox 4.3.14 for Linux hosts Vagrant : vagrant_1.6.3_i686.deb VirtualBoxのインストール VMアプリケーションのインストール ここからVirtualBoxをダウンロー…